Olympic ice rink at Hamar Hamar is a city in Hedmark, Norway, facing the impressive Mjøsa lake. The city, which has a population presence of 31,000, was first established in the middle of the 11th century, but destroyed by a Swedish army in 1567.

In 1849 the city was re-established, and is now the largest city in the Norwegian inland (i.e. the counties not connected to the ocean). During the 1994 Winter Olympics three of the sporting events were held in Hamar: Figure skating, short track speed skating and speed skating.

By car

Take the E6 national highway north from Oslo. Takes roughly 1.5 hours. From Oslo Airport it takes an hour.

Travel by train to Hamar

All trains between Oslo-Trondheim, Oslo-Røros and Skien-Lillehammer stop in /en/our-destinations/stations/hamar-station?id=0711 Hamar. 1 hour 15 min from Oslo, about 1 hour from Gardermoen Airport. From Lillehammer a trip takes 45 min, and from Elverum 25 min.

How to get around in Hamar

Travel on a Bus in Hamar

There are five bus lines in the city, going from the suburbs and through the downtown. The cost is 33 NOK for a single ticket if you buy on the bus.

Best way to travel in Hamar by a Taxi

Taxis are expensive. The minimum charge in Hamar is at least 97 NOK, increasing to 141 NOK late at weekend nights. The phone number for Hedmark Taxi is 03650.

  • Vikingskipet - The Viking ship, Hamar Olympic Hall - Åkersvikveien 1 60.79288, 11.10100 - 30 NOK Vikingskipet - The Viking Ship, officially known as Hamar olympiahall (Hamar Olympic Hall), is a modern speed skating arena, and was built for the 1994 Olympic Winter Games. It name comes form its appearance: an upside-down Viking ship. It regularly hosts major speed skating events, such as world championships. Also known for hosting The Gathering each Easter, a computer gathering mainly for young people which has had over 5,000 participants. Each spring and fall and the Vikingship also hosts a very popular 3-day long market for second-hand/ antique goods. The Viking Ship is situated near Åkersvika, a nature reserve, known for it's rich bird life. At the parking lot there is a "bird tower", where you can get a good view of the bay.
  • Domkirkeodden - Strandvegen 100, 2315 60.79199, 11.03624 From downtown follow signs for museums ☎ +47 62 54 27 00 - A must-see. Medieval cathedral and folk museum along Lake Myøsa. The ruins of the cathedral are encased in a glass house. Lovely walks and beaches by the lake. The open air museum is free and open year round, all the time. The opening hours of the museum vary according to season. There's a nice cafe there as well. Concerts and theater productions are often held in the glass house, but be sure to bring a blanket with you in the evenings- even in the summer, it gets cold there after the sun sets! The Medieval Festival usually takes place here over a long weekend in June.

  • Ankerskogen swimming hall - Ankerskogen svømmehall - Ankerskogveien 7, 2319 60.80378, 11.06649 ☎ +4746918000 Opening Hours: Monday - Friday 10.00 - 21.00 Saturday & Sunday 10.00 - 17.00 Early morning swimming-Monday to Wed- Friday 06.30 - 08.30 weekdays: adults 157;student/youth/senior 130; children 3-12 100;children 0-2 53 (nappy suitable for bathing included). At weekends all tickets are NOK 10 more expensive.: Ankerskogv. 7, 2319 Hamar The main swimmingpool is one of Norway's largest, 25x50m. Part of this swimmingpool is roped off and has all sort of special floats for kids. There's also a specially heated swimmingpool for rehabilitation, a kiddie pool, and a hot tub (cost 10 kr per round), a shallow outdoor swimmingpool which is open in summertime. Also a 65 meter slide which kids love. There are huge windows all around the pool, so in the winter you can swim while you watch the snow blowing outside. The changing rooms have saunas. You need a 10 kr coin to operate the lockers, or bring your own lock. Ankerskogen also has indoor tennis courts and a Nautilus gym. You'll also find a cafeteria here. The center was due to be renovated starting in 2010, but they planned on staying open to the public the whole time.

  • Skibladner | 60.79246, 11.06751 - Prices from kr. 210 per person. Return fare: single fare + kr. 100,- Skibladner Skibladner is the world's oldest preserved paddle steamer, and sails on lake Mjøsa during the summer.
